Dr. Billings is a therapist who specializes in psychoanalysis. The types of techniques that she is likely

to use would include
A. systematic desensitization and token economies.
B. teaching clients to replace their fears systematically with more relaxed responses.
C. free association, dream interpretation, transference, and interpreting the client's resistance
to discussing painful memories.
D. prescribing strong medication that will reduce the client's anxiety so that the client can learn
to relax and gain insight.

Final answer:

Dr. Billings, as a psychoanalyst, would use techniques such as free association and dream interpretation, which are in line with Freud's methods for accessing and understanding the unconscious mind to treat psychological disturbances.

Step-by-step explanation:

Dr. Billings, as a therapist specializing in psychoanalysis, is likely to use techniques consistent with Freudian tradition. The techniques she is likely to employ include free association, dream interpretation, transference, and interpreting the client's resistance to discussing painful memories. These methods are rooted in Sigmund Freud's belief in the importance of accessing the unconscious mind to resolve repressed emotions and traumatic experiences from childhood that are manifesting as psychological disturbances. Psychoanalysis aims to help clients uncover and understand these unconscious motivations to facilitate healing and personal growth.
